In the legal arena, medical marijuana is a complex issue in the United States. Although many states allow its use for treating various conditions, federal law still prohibits its use. This situation creates confusion and challenges for both users and producers/distributors.

The medicinal use of cannabis presents a lesser-known dimension:

In the United States, despite federal marijuana prohibition, several states have legalized its use for medicinal purposes to treat symptoms such as pain and nausea.

Medical marijuana, also known as medicinal cannabis, refers to derivatives of the Cannabis sativa plant used to relieve symptoms related to various medical conditions.

The plant contains several active compounds, including THC and CBD, with THC being responsible for the characteristic psychoactive effects of cannabis.

At the federal level, the use of cannabis and its derivatives is prohibited, although CBD derived from hemp (with low THC content) is legal. However, state laws may allow THC for therapeutic purposes, though federal laws prevail.

Eligibility for medical marijuana treatment varies by state and the medical conditions covered in their regulations.

While medical marijuana has been observed to have benefits for certain conditions, further research is needed to determine its safety. Possible side effects include changes in heart rate, dizziness, and cognitive alterations, among others.

Although not approved by the FDA for any medical condition, there are FDA-approved cannabinoids such as cannabidiol (Epidiolex) and dronabinol (Marinol, Syndros) for treating certain conditions.

Medical marijuana comes in various forms such as pills, liquids, oils, powders, and dried leaves, and its acquisition and use vary by state. In institutions like the Mayo Clinic, in states like Minnesota, some healthcare providers may authorize medical marijuana use for patients meeting state-established requirements. However, in other Mayo Clinic locations, such as in Arizona and Florida, medical marijuana use is not permitted.

 What is Creatine?

Creatine is a naturally occurring compound classified as a nitrogenous organic acid that plays a crucial role in energy metabolism, particularly in muscle cells. Its primary function is to facilitate the regeneration of adenosine triphosphate (ATP), which serves as the primary energy currency within cells. While creatine is predominantly found in animal-based food sources such as red meat and fish, it can also be synthesized endogenously in the human body from a combination of amino acids, including arginine, glycine, and methionine. This ability to be produced internally, along with its presence in certain dietary sources, contributes to creatine’s importance in maintaining cellular energy levels and supporting overall physiological functions, especially in tissues with high energy demands like skeletal muscles.

Forms of Creatine

 

Creatine is available in several forms, including:

  • Creatine Monohydrate: The most common and researched form, known for its effectiveness and affordability.

  • Creatine Ethyl Ester: A form that is claimed to be more easily absorbed but lacks substantial research backing.

  • Buffered Creatine: Designed to reduce the acidity of creatine, potentially improving its stability and absorption.

 

Potential Benefits of Using Creatine for Cannabis Plants

 

 1. Enhanced Energy Production

 

One of the primary functions of creatine is to facilitate energy production. In plants, energy is crucial for various processes, including photosynthesis, nutrient uptake, and growth. Some growers hypothesize that introducing creatine could enhance these energy-dependent processes, leading to more vigorous growth.

 

2. Nutrient Absorption

 

Creatine contains nitrogen, a vital nutrient for plants. Nitrogen is essential for the synthesis of amino acids, proteins, and chlorophyll, all of which are critical for healthy plant development. Some anecdotal evidence suggests that creatine may improve nutrient absorption in cannabis plants, potentially leading to better growth and yields.

 

 3. Stress Resistance

 

Cannabis plants can experience various forms of stress, including drought, nutrient deficiency, and pest attacks. Some proponents of creatine use argue that it may help plants cope with stress by enhancing their overall vitality and resilience. This could be particularly beneficial during critical growth phases or when plants are exposed to challenging environmental conditions.

 

 4. Improved Root Development

 

Healthy root systems are crucial for nutrient and water uptake. Some growers believe that creatine may promote root growth and development, leading to a stronger foundation for the plant. A robust root system can enhance the plant’s ability to absorb nutrients and water, ultimately contributing to better overall health.

 

 Concerns and Limitations

 

 1. Lack of Scientific Research

 

While there are numerous anecdotal reports regarding the benefits of using creatine for cannabis plants, scientific research on this topic is limited. Most claims are based on personal experiences rather than controlled studies. As a result, the effectiveness and safety of using creatine in cannabis cultivation remain largely unverified.

 

2. Potential Risks of Overuse

 

Using creatine in excessive amounts could lead to negative effects on cannabis plants. Over-saturation may cause water retention, potentially leading to root rot or other issues associated with overwatering. It is essential to approach any supplementation cautiously and monitor plant health closely.

 

3. Soil pH Concerns

 

Creatine may affect soil pH levels, which can impact nutrient availability and uptake. Cannabis plants thrive in a specific pH range (typically between 6.0 and 7.0 for soil). If creatine alters the pH significantly, it could lead to nutrient lockout or deficiencies, adversely affecting plant health.

 

4. Compatibility with Other Nutrients

 

Creatine’s interaction with other nutrients and fertilizers is not well understood. When introducing any new supplement, it is essential to consider how it might affect the overall nutrient balance in the soil. Compatibility issues could lead to nutrient imbalances, negatively impacting plant health and growth.

 

 Practical Considerations for Using Creatine

 

 1. Dosage and Application

 

If you decide to experiment with creatine, start with a diluted solution. A common approach is to mix a small amount of creatine monohydrate with water and apply it as a foliar spray or soil drench. Begin with a low concentration to observe how the plants respond before increasing the dosage.

 2. Monitoring Plant Health

 

Closely monitor your plants after introducing creatine. Look for signs of improvement, such as increased growth rates, healthier leaves, and robust root systems. Conversely, be vigilant for any negative effects, such as wilting, yellowing leaves, or signs of stress.

 

 3. Combining with Other Nutrients

 

Consider using creatine in conjunction with a balanced nutrient regimen. Ensure that your plants receive adequate macronutrients (nitrogen, phosphorus, potassium) and micronutrients (calcium, magnesium, iron) to support overall health. Creatine should not replace essential nutrients but rather complement them.

 

4. Timing of Application

 

Timing is crucial when applying any supplement. Consider using creatine during the vegetative stage when plants are actively growing and require more energy and nutrients. Avoid using it during flowering, as this stage has different nutrient needs and may be more sensitive to changes in the growing environment.

 

Conclusion

 

While the idea of using creatine as a supplement for cannabis plants is intriguing, it is essential to approach this practice with caution. The potential benefits, such as enhanced energy production, improved nutrient absorption, and stress resistance, are largely based on anecdotal evidence rather than scientific research. If you choose to experiment with creatine, start with small doses, monitor plant health closely, and ensure that it complements a balanced nutrient regimen. As with any cultivation practice, what works for one grower may not work for another, so personal experience and careful observation will be key to determining the effectiveness of creatine in your cannabis growing endeavors.

Decarboxylation Unveiled: A Crucial Prelude

Before we embark on the journey through ingredients and their orchestration within our recipe, let us delve into a pivotal aspect – a lesson gleaned from our culinary odysseys. While the process of smoking or vaporizing cannabis initiates decarboxylation, transforming THCa into the renowned psychoactive THC, this alchemical transformation does not spontaneously occur during culinary endeavors. Thus, it becomes imperative to conduct decarboxylation prior to commencing the cooking journey. For an optimal outcome, embark on the act of finely grinding the buds, employing a grinder as your ally. Both leaves and blossoms hold their significance. Preheat your oven to a temperature ranging from 100 to 105°C (212-221°F). Gently distribute the finely ground cannabis atop parchment paper on a baking tray, allowing it to grace the oven’s embrace for approximately 45 minutes. Upon completion, the cannabis undergoes a visual metamorphosis, adorning itself in a resplendent golden-brown hue and an invitingly crumbly texture.

FAQ

  • How long does it take for cannabis-infused ice cream to take effect?
    The effects of cannabis-infused ice cream can take 1 to 2 hours to manifest due to the slower absorption through digestion.
  • Do I need to decarboxylate the cannabis before making the ice cream?
    Yes, decarboxylation is essential to activate the THC. This involves baking the cannabis at a low temperature before incorporating it into the recipe.
  • Can I use alternative sweeteners in the recipe?
    Absolutely! You can substitute sugar with options like stevia, agave, maple syrup, coconut sugar, or birch syrup to suit your preferences.
